#b88c42 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b88c42 is composed of 72.2% red, 54.9%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.9% magenta, 64.1%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 37.6 degrees, a saturation of 47.2% and a lightness of 49%. #b88c42 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ff84 with #711900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

Shades and Tints of #b88c42

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0804 is the darkest color, while #fefd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#b88c42

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7d7c is the less saturated color, while #f29b08 is the most saturated one.
